The total rental price for a 12-passenger van rarely reflects the full financial picture. The base daily rate is just the starting point. Hidden in plain sight are fuel allowances, insurance fees, stress surcharges, maintenance reserves, and taxes—charges that can add 25% to 40% to the listed price, depending on the provider and rental duration. Some companies bundle minimal fuel, but in reality, always verify what’s included and what’s extra.

- Maintenance Reserves: Providers set aside 5–10% of the base cost for wear and tear—not billed upfront but essential to total spend.
- Daily Base Rate: Typically ranges from $120–$200, depending on season, provider, and mileage allowance.
- Insurance and Fees: Mandatory coverage, handling fees, and administrative charges add 10–20% to the core cost.

- Fuel Allowance (if included): Usually baked into the rate for short rentals, but verify limits—some include no more than 100 miles or exclude long-distance travel. What’s the weekly cost? With daily rates and fuel, expect $800–$1,300 weekly depending on usage and route.
- Mileage Caps: Some agreements limit daily driving to 200 miles—beyond that, rates jump or fuel allowances reset.

Core Questions About Total Van Rental Cost
How much does a 12-passenger van really cost per day? It starts around $150–$180, but total depends on fuel, mileage, and fees.
Do long-distance routes inflate the price? Yes—fuel rates rise outside major corridors, and remote areas may reduce service availability.
